كيفية تثبيت Node.js و NPM على نظام Mac OS
جدول المحتويات:
Node JS هي بيئة تشغيل جافا سكريبت الشائعة التي يستخدمها العديد من المطورين على نطاق واسع ، و npm هو مدير الحزم المصاحب لبيئة Node.js و Javascript. عند تثبيت Node.js ، ستجد أن npm مثبت أيضًا ، وبالتالي إذا كنت تريد npm فأنت بحاجة إلى تثبيت NodeJS.
هناك عدة طرق لتثبيت Node.js و NPM على جهاز Mac ، بما في ذلك استخدام أداة التثبيت المجمعة مسبقًا ، أو باستخدام Homebrew. سيغطي هذا البرنامج التعليمي كليهما ، ويجب أن يعمل أي من النهجين على أي إصدار حديث من برنامج نظام MacOS.
كيفية تثبيت Node.js و npm على نظام التشغيل Mac OS باستخدام Homebrew
أسهل طريقة لتثبيت node.js و npm هي باستخدام مدير حزمة Homebrew ، مما يعني أنك ستحتاج أولاً إلى تثبيت Homebrew على جهاز Mac إذا لم تكن قد قمت بذلك بالفعل. من الجيد دائمًا تحديث Homebrew قبل تثبيت حزمة Homebrew ، لذا قم بتشغيل الأمر التالي للقيام بذلك:
تحديث المشروب
بافتراض أن لديك بالفعل Homebrew على جهاز Mac ، فيمكنك تشغيل الأمر التالي في تطبيق Terminal لتثبيت كل من Node.js و npm:
عقدة تثبيت الشراب
يمكن القول إن تثبيت NodeJS / NPM عبر Homebrew أسهل من استخدام أي طريقة أخرى ، كما أنه يجعل من السهل الحفاظ على تحديث node.js و npm. كما أن لديها ميزة إضافية تتمثل في تسهيل عملية إلغاء التثبيت على الطريق إذا قررت أنك لم تعد بحاجة إليها.
تثبيت Node.js & NPM على جهاز Mac باستخدام أداة تثبيت الحزمة
إذا كنت لا ترغب في استخدام Homebrew لأي سبب من الأسباب ، فإن الخيار الأسهل التالي هو استخدام أداة التثبيت التي تم إنشاؤها مسبقًا من nodejs.org:
يمكنك تشغيل برنامج التثبيت مثل أي حزمة تثبيت أخرى على جهاز Mac.
كيفية التحقق من تثبيت NPM و Node.js على جهاز Mac
بعد تثبيت node.js مع npm ، يمكنك التأكد من تثبيت الاثنين بإصدار أي من الأمرين بعلامة a -v للتحقق من الإصدار:
node -v
و
npm -v
كيفية اختبار عمل Node.js
بمجرد تثبيت حزمة node.js على جهاز Mac ، يمكنك اختبار عملها عن طريق بدء خادم ويب بسيط. قم بإنشاء ملف باسم "app.js" يحتوي على بناء جملة التعليمات البرمجية التالي:
احفظ ملف app.js هذا في الدليل الحالي ، ثم يمكنك بدء تشغيل خادم الويب بالأمر التالي:
node app.js
ثم قم بتشغيل متصفح الويب (الافتراضي الخاص بك أو غير ذلك) وانتقل إلى عنوان URL التالي:
http: // localhost: 3000
يجب أن ترى رسالة تفيد "مرحبًا من Node.js".
خادم الويب node.js البسيط هذا يشبه إلى حد ما خادم الويب الفوري Python باستثناء أنه يستخدم بالطبع العقدة بدلاً من Python. عند الحديث عن Python ، إذا كنت تقوم بتثبيت Node.js و NPM ، فقد تكون مهتمًا أيضًا بغرس Python 3 المحدث على جهاز Mac أيضًا.
يمكنك أيضًا تثبيت واستخدام Grunt CLI Task runner لاختبار العقدة و npm ، والتي يمكن تثبيتها من خلال npm:
npm install -g grunt-cli
يمكنك بعد ذلك تشغيل "grunt" من سطر الأوامر.
يجب أن يغطي ذلك أساسيات تثبيت NodeJS و npm على جهاز Mac. إذا كانت لديك أي نصائح أو حيل أو اقتراحات أو نصائح أخرى ، فلا تتردد في مشاركتها في التعليقات أدناه.